Hi all,
before we write off the category system (as living-in-the-future-Gerard seems 
to do ;-) we should probably rather think about killing galleries. All of them. 
Completely. Galleries require a considerable maintenance overhead, and I would 
argue that that work is better spent on categorizing our content. We could 
replace galleries by allowing select images to retain high level categories 
(for example through a template so the don't accidentally get diffused down the 
tree). The captions in galleries are just an i18n nightmare and a data 
duplication of the description texts.
This does not entirely solve the problem of still having the Creator namespace, 
but if were up to me, we'd _not_ interwikilink there, but rather to the "Works 
by .." category, because that is what I think people expect to find on commons: 
Images Cheers, Daniel

>> This is one reason I create the pahbricator request for Commons to have its 
>> own Site box rather than fall under "Other wiki's". That would allow us to 
>> link an item to its corresponding Gallery, Category, Creator or whatever. 
>> Right now we can only like to Commons category via the Other Wiki's and 
>> although we can link Galleries, Creator and the like as data items, they are 
>> not "linked" as site links.
